Posted inAlbum / Single Reviews
Album Review ~ Transport League ~ ‘We Are Satan’s People’
The album We Are Satan's People from Transport League is coming out from Sound Pollution / Black…
I'm Music Magazine is your one stop pop culture source for news, interviews, concert reviews & more